#2fbf4e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2fbf4e is composed of 18.4% red, 74.9%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.2% yellow and 25.1% black. It has a hue angle of 132.9 degrees, a saturation of 60.5% and a lightness of 46.7%. #2fbf4e color hex could be obtained by blending #5eff9c with #007f00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#2fbf4e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010201 is the darkest color, while #f1fcf4 is the lightest one.
